#1b0ada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b0ada is composed of 10.6% red, 3.9%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.6% cyan, 95.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 244.9 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 44.7%. #1b0ada color hex could be obtained by blending #3614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#1b0ada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b0ada has RGB values of R:27, G:10,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1772250.

Shades and Tints of #1b0ada
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010c is the darkest color, while #f8f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b0ada
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6a7a is the less saturated color, while #1401e3 is the most saturated one.
